latinindustry

Members Login
Username 
 
Password 
    Remember Me  
Posts Tagged With "emerging nations" Forum Replies Views Last Post
No New Posts industry leadership, colombia, emerging nations, latin america (Preview) colombia emerging market, business development 2 1290
Page 1 of 1


Create your own FREE Forum
Report Abuse
Powered by ActiveBoard